Jagadhatri Upcoming Twist: Jagadhatri and Shivay Find Gyan Dead, Murder Mystery Deepens

The episode of Jagadhatri takes a shocking turn when Jagadhatri finally tracks down Gyan and reaches his house, completely unaware that she is about to stumble upon a murder scene. What follows is a tense confrontation between Jagadhatri and Shivay, with both officers forced to question each other while trying to understand who killed Gyan.

Jagadhatri reaches Gyan’s house while following the case and enters in her official avatar. She keeps her gun ready and calls out for Gyan, expecting him to respond. However, there is no answer.

When Jagadhatri notices Gyan sitting in his chair, she moves closer and turns the chair around. She is left completely stunned when she sees that Gyan has been brutally stabbed in the stomach and is already dead.

The discovery shakes Jagadhatri. She had been trying to track Gyan down, but she never expected to find him murdered. Her immediate concern is to figure out who killed Gyan and why.

Just then, Shivay also reaches the location with his gun. Hearing a sound, Jagadhatri quickly turns around with her weapon pointed forward. To her surprise, she finds Shivay standing there.

The two undercover officers come face-to-face, and the atmosphere immediately becomes tense. Although they are husband and wife personally, they are also professionals working undercover. With Gyan dead and both of them arriving at the crime scene separately, questions naturally arise.

Shivay looks at Gyan and realizes that he has been murdered. He questions Jagadhatri about what happened and asks who killed him. He also wants to know why she followed Gyan to this location.

Jagadhatri refuses to simply answer his questions. Instead, she turns the question back on Shivay and asks what he is doing at Gyan’s house. Neither of them is willing to reveal everything immediately, making their confrontation even more complicated.

Jagadhatri then takes an important precaution. She wipes away the fingerprints and other traces she may have accidentally left behind, including marks around the doors and the chair. She knows that since she was at the crime scene, even an innocent presence could create suspicion if proper precautions are not taken.

She then calls the police and informs them about the murder. Jagadhatri also begins examining the surroundings and questioning Shivay about whether he noticed anyone leaving the area.

Shivay reveals that while coming towards the location, he encountered a man who bumped into him. The stranger had covered himself completely and appeared to be in a hurry. This immediately gives Jagadhatri a possible lead.

She instructs the officers accompanying her to search for the unidentified man. Jagadhatri believes he could have information about Gyan’s murder or might even be directly connected to the crime. The officers are asked to follow him before he manages to get too far away.

The investigation, however, is not the only thing creating tension between Jagadhatri and Shivay. Once they return home, another disagreement begins between the two.

Shivay comes across a file belonging to his grandfather, which leads to another argument. Their professional responsibilities are now beginning to interfere with their personal relationship.

Jagadhatri remains determined to uncover the truth, even if the investigation takes her closer to people within her own circle. Shivay, meanwhile, becomes upset with her approach and eventually walks away.

Jagadhatri is left trying to process everything that has happened. She knows that Gyan’s murder cannot be ignored and that someone is hiding the truth. Her determination remains clear as she decides to get to the root of the mistake and uncover the person responsible.

At the same time, Shivay and Jagadhatri must find a way to separate their personal emotions from their professional duties. Their growing disagreements could make their investigation more difficult, especially when both of them appear to have questions about each other’s movements.

Review

This episode takes the Jagadhatri storyline into a much darker investigative phase. Gyan’s murder creates an intriguing mystery, while the unidentified man gives Jagadhatri and Shivay an immediate lead to pursue. The strongest part is the tension between the two undercover officers because their professional suspicion is now affecting their personal relationship as well. The upcoming episodes should be interesting if Jagadhatri and Shivay manage to follow the mysterious man’s trail and uncover the real killer.

Rating: 4/5
